Latest Patents

Händle's latest patents include an electro-hydrostatic drive system and a hydraulic system. The electro-hydrostatic drive system involves a hydraulic machine driven by an electric motor, designed to provide a volumetric flow rate of hydraulic fluid. This system operates within a closed hydraulic circuit, maintaining overpressure relative to the environment. It allows for movement in both directions through controlled volumetric flow rates.

The hydraulic system patent describes a drive that consists of a working cylinder and a travel cylinder, which are interconnected. This design features a closed pressure circuit filled with hydraulic fluid, enabling efficient operation with a minimum number of components. The system is designed to improve energy efficiency while maintaining low installation complexity.
